Blind Faith
An old man walks steadily down a forest path. He comes to a clearing, where he finds the path splits into several branches, each leading off in an individual direction.
Having faced many decisions in his lifetime--and regretting most--he decides to let fate decide his destiny, so he closes his eyes and continues to walk straight down the path on which he was already headed.
Continuing down this path, he basks in the comfort and solitude that closing his eyes affords him. He revels in the idea that, though he may have been able to see before, he does not feel blind while letting fate run its course.
The cedar trees around him give off an intoxicating aroma that he has only just now become aware of. He can hear the sound of his footsteps grinding the dirt on the worn path below.
The man stops, deciding that it is a good time to rest.
Suddenly, a tiger charges from the underbrush after a small rabbit which dances through the man's legs in search of some--any--cover.
The tiger runs full force into the man's legs, having not noticed he was even there, so set was she to catch that tiny rabbit.
Without opening his eyes, the man is swept off his feet, and lands with a dull thud against the rough stones on the path.
